If the drive had a hard enough impact and the platters have contacted you wont get them to overcome the stiction.

I have managed to get drives to run for around 15 minutes for data recovery using the freezing method but be aware that this is a last ditch recovery method. There's an explanation here (http://geeksaresexy.blogspot.com/2006/01/freeze-your-hard-drive-to-recover-data.html) but essentially you freeze the drive to contract the platters overcoming stiction then run it up and pull data off like there's no tomorrow.

What he doesn't mention is silica gel packs - if you can get them (they're in shoe boxes) they help prevent the moisture invading the device.

Heres the steps I took to freeze it:

1: Took the HDD out of the 24c ambient room and left it in an 18c room.
2: Stuck it in the fridge for a couple of hours with 'Super Cool' on, meant the air would circulate more and less chance of condensation.
3: Filled a bowl with cold, chilled, water :D
4: Put the HDD in a ziplock bag with as many silica paks as I could find and sealed it 75% shut.
5: Dipped the bag with HDD into the water leaving the opened top out the water and zipped it shut. Had to do this carefully. It meant as much air as possible was pushed out by the water pressure.
6: Dried the bag without puncturing it.
7: Put the HDD into the freezer and hit 'Fast Freeze'.

I actually had to wait for the drive to thaw out a bit because it was so cold it wouldnt move, my fingers even got stuck to it when I took it out the freezer after about 3hrs. It was a fail.

I swapped the PCBs and the PCB still worked the new drive.

For the finale I cleaned and hoovered all surfaces, closed the door to my computer room, slapped on a pair of medical gloves and put the extractor on full blast and opened it up.

The top platter has 2 massive rings on it and the heads just jump between them. The heads go into the ramp and move ok on their own, all except reading the actual disk.

Conclusion: Platters are boned so theres nothing I can do except rebuild the collection of things I need and now I have a spare set of heads for my new HDD.
